WebOct 30, 2024 · Java - Including BST. 4. Finding size of largest subtree of a bst contained in a range. 0. Minimum number of levels in BST given the number of nodes. 1. Determine if binary tree is BST haskell. 3. convert Sorted Linked List to Balanced BST. 0. binary search tree (BST) find method in C#. 1. How to check if the given Node is the root of a BST in ... WebNov 28, 2024 · A Simple Solution is to traverse nodes in Inorder and one by one insert into a self-balancing BST like AVL tree. Time complexity of this solution is O (n Log n) and this solution doesn’t guarantee the minimum possible height as in the worst case the height of the AVL tree can be 1.44*log2n.
Binary Search Tree In Java – Implementation & Code …
WebJul 21, 2024 · public static TreeNode findNodeInTree (TreeNode root, TreeNode nodeToFind) { if (root == null) { return null; } if (root.data == nodeToFind.data) { return root; } TreeNode found = null; if (root.left != null) { found = findNodeInTree (root.left, nodeToFind); if (found != null) { return found; } } if (root.right != null) { found = findNodeInTree … WebNov 20, 2014 · 1 You are assigning a non null value to parent in the recursive calls : parent = findParent (x, node.left, node); ---- parent = findParent (x, node.right, node); ---- parent is null only in the initial call (since the root of the tree has no parent). red lion surgery cannock reviews
java - Binary Search Tree: Recursive toString - Stack Overflow
WebApr 20, 2024 · You can also use a BST, where the flow and structure of data are constantly entering or leaving, such as the map and set methods in most programming languages, including Java. We can also use BST in three-dimensional video games to determine the position of objects and the rendering process. WebFig 1: Find element in BST If we would like to search node, having value 70 Then program should return Node G If we would like to search node … WebMar 15, 2024 · Step 1: Start Step 2: Create a function called “findParent” that has two inputs: height and node. This function returns a number that represents the binary tree’s parent node for the specified node. a. Set the initial values of the two variables “start” and “end” to 1 and 2height – 1, respectively. b. richard medved